Output 17c41a5426b34124b55a2b1ee95dbaee0eb6890e0053297f087c4c212fa2f287:0

value
512542117
script pubkey
OP_0 OP_PUSHBYTES_20 5e08505fc66c4cfdc87ecf8dcd314898248ac0d2
address
tb1qtcy9qh7xd3x0mjr7e7xu6v2gnqjg4sxjqnmf99
transaction
17c41a5426b34124b55a2b1ee95dbaee0eb6890e0053297f087c4c212fa2f287
confirmations
65926
spent
true